Mirrored Sunglasses Bulk Sourcing Risk Guide

This guide is for eyewear brands, importers, distributors, and retailers ordering mirrored sunglasses in bulk. Mirror lenses often fail because buyers approve the look, while production must control material, tint, coating, handling, assembly, packing, and inspection limits. A vague order such as "blue mirror lens, UV400" is not enough. Use this guide to write clearer specs, approve physical samples, and reduce mismatches between trial orders, bulk runs, and reorders.

Where mirrored sunglass orders fail

Mirror coating looks simple on a sales sample. It is not simple in bulk.

The buyer sees color and shine. The factory must control the lens substrate, base tint, coating recipe, coating equipment, film thickness, curing or drying, cleaning, handling, assembly, and packing. A small change in any step can change the final look.

The failures are common: a blue mirror turns slightly purple, a silver mirror shows pinholes near the edge, a gold mirror gets rubbing marks in packing, or a reorder does not match the first shipment. These problems rarely start at final inspection. They usually start with a weak purchase order.

Separate three variables before you approve anything: lens material, base tint, and mirror layer. A smoke base with blue mirror will not match a brown base with blue mirror. A darker base can hide small coating variation. A lighter base can make color drift obvious.

Choose the base tint before the mirror color

Mirror color is not a standalone choice. It sits over the base lens.

If the base is too light, the outside may look bright, but the wearer may get more glare than expected. If the base is too dark, the product may feel heavy during retail try-on, even if it performs well outdoors.

For fashion and promotional sunglasses, common base colors include smoke, gray, brown, green, and gradient. Common mirror options include silver, blue, green, red, orange, gold, rose, and rainbow effects. For sport or performance programs, also define visible light transmission, lens category, distortion limits, and polarization.

Mirror optionTypical visual effectBulk production riskBuyer control action
Silver mirrorClean reflective surface; works with many frame colorsShows fingerprints, pinholes, edge voids, and cleaning marks clearlyUse strict handling rules and inspect under angled light
Blue mirrorStrong retail color for beach, sport, and promotional stylesCan shift toward purple or cyan if the base tint or coating density changesApprove against a physical master sample, not a phone photo
Gold mirrorWarm premium look on black, tortoise, brown, or clear framesFine scratches and rubbing marks are easy to seeConsider lens film, tray separation, or individual sleeves before assembly
Red/orange mirrorHigh-impact fashion and event lookShade repeatability can be harder across coating batches and reordersDefine acceptable shade range before mass production
Green mirrorOutdoor, fishing, and sport appearanceMay look dull on the wrong base tintConfirm both outside reflection and wearer-view color

Do not approve mirror lenses from studio photos alone. Lighting angle changes the apparent color. Ask for a physical pre-production sample. Keep one signed master sample at the factory and one with your team. Label it with style code, lens material, base tint, mirror color, date, and approver name.

Write a mirror lens spec QC can use

A good spec turns appearance into a production target. It gives QC a reason to reject bad parts. It also protects reorders.

A practical cosmetic tolerance may state: no visible scratch in the central viewing zone at the agreed inspection distance, no obvious coating void in the main field of view, and only minor edge defects outside normal view. The exact tolerance depends on price point, retail channel, and AQL agreement. Write it before production.

For EU sunglass sales, CE marking supported by EN ISO 12312-1 testing is commonly required for non-prescription sunglasses. For the US, ANSI Z80.3 is a key non-prescription sunglass standard, and FDA registration or listing obligations may apply depending on the product and the role of the manufacturer, importer, or private labeler. For Australia and New Zealand, AS/NZS 1067 applies. REACH covers chemical substance restrictions for materials and components; it is not an optical performance standard. ISO 9001 relates to quality management systems. BSCI relates to social compliance audits. Neither proves that mirror color, VLT, UV performance, or scratch resistance is correct. Product claims and packaging must match valid reports and the legal rules of the target market.

Control material, coating, and handling

Many promotional and fashion sunglasses use PC lenses. PC is light, impact resistant, and suitable for many injected-frame designs. But a tough lens body does not make the mirror surface scratch-proof.

The mirror layer is a surface finish. It can be damaged by dirty cloths, lens-to-lens contact, rough packing, poor cleaning, or handling the lens instead of the frame.

TAC polarized lenses add more risk points. Polarization layers, lamination, tint density, and coating adhesion must be checked during sampling. If the product will be sold as polarized, confirm the claim with the right lens construction and an inspection method that verifies polarization. A mirrored lens is not automatically polarized.

Mirror coatings are commonly applied by vacuum deposition or a related coating process. Final appearance depends on base tint, coating recipe, layer thickness, equipment condition, process stability, and post-coating handling. Small differences can be visible, especially on red, orange, rose, and gold mirrors. For larger orders, ask whether the full order will be coated in one lot or several lots. Ask how those lots will be identified.

Hard coating can improve abrasion resistance, but it does not make a mirror lens immune to scratches. For high-reflection colors such as silver and gold, use stronger process controls: separated trays, clean gloves, non-abrasive cloths, and no lens-to-lens contact. Prevention beats final re-cleaning.

Approve the lens, not just the frame

A mirrored sunglass sample needs more than one approval. Check the frame fit, lens base tint, mirror appearance, and decoration. Many buyers focus on logo placement and frame color. Then the lens becomes an afterthought. That is risky. On mirrored sunglasses, the lens often carries the whole product.

Use this approval sequence:

  1. First sample: confirm frame shape, material, lens base tint, mirror direction, decoration method, and general fit. Confirm sample timing in writing because it depends on frame material, lens requirement, logo complexity, tooling, and special components.
  2. Correction sample: adjust mirror shade, base tint darkness, logo size, hinge feel, or temple print position if needed. Do not approve "almost right" if lens color is central to the product.
  3. Signed master sample: approve a physical pair as the production standard. Keep one with the buyer and one sealed at the factory.
  4. Pre-production check: compare the first bulk-coated lenses against the master before full assembly.
  5. Final inspection: check assembled sunglasses for color consistency, scratches, lens seating, logo quality, hinge function, labeling, and packing.

Decoration can also create problems. Pad printing is cost efficient for temples, but ink and surface treatment must match. Laser engraving is clean on metal or selected coated parts, but it may look subtle on some plastics. Metal logo plates can look higher value, but adhesive or pin fixing must be controlled. Hot stamping and UV printing can work for fashion effects. Test them. Use rub testing or tape testing before approval.

MOQ, price, and lead time: know the trade-offs

A small trial order and a large commercial order should not be managed the same way.

Small MOQs help with market tests, influencer drops, retailer presentations, and private-label trials. Larger quantities can lower unit cost, but they also make mistakes expensive. A small coating issue on a test order may be manageable. The same issue on a chain-retail shipment can become a claim.

Larger order tiers can reduce unit cost because setup, material purchasing, coating preparation, decoration setup, and packing labor are spread across more units. Ask for a written quotation that separates frame, lens, mirror coating, logo method, pouch or case, barcode labeling, testing, and inspection needs. That makes cost drivers easier to see.

Order sizeBest useMain mirror lens riskRecommended control
Small trial orderMarket test, sample sale, influencer dropBuyers may approve color casually because volume is lowStill keep a signed master sample for reorder
First commercial batchBoutique retail run or first paid market launchSmall shade drift becomes visible across cartonsCheck first bulk lenses before full assembly
Importer or seasonal programRegional launch, catalogue program, or seasonal retail orderHandling scratches, mixed coating lots, packing variationUse tray separation, lot labels, and written defect limits
Distributor or chain-retail volumeHigh-volume retail, distributor stock, or repeated programBatch variation, reorder mismatch, stricter compliance exposureLock specs, retain masters, inspect carton spread, document lots

Count lead time from approved sample, confirmed specification, and agreed payment terms. Do not count from the first inquiry. Custom mirror colors, polarized lenses, special cases, barcode labeling, multiple logo positions, third-party testing, and repeated shade corrections can all extend the schedule. If the delivery date is fixed, freeze the lens standard early. Late tint and coating changes are costly.

Reorders need lot control

Reorder mismatch is one of the most common mirror-lens problems. Buyers assume the factory will repeat the last lens exactly. That is not automatic.

The style code may be the same, but the base tint, coating recipe, raw lens batch, or supplier input may have changed. The difference becomes obvious when old stock and new stock sit together on the same retail shelf.

Build a reorder file for every mirrored sunglass program. Include lens material, lens thickness, base tint, mirror color, frame color, decoration method, logo artwork, packaging, compliance requirements, previous inspection notes, and master sample reference. Photos are useful for communication, but they are not a final color standard. Lighting, camera settings, and screens all distort mirror color.

Ask the factory to compare first reorder output against the retained master before completing the run. If the master sample has aged, scratched, faded, or been lost, approve a fresh standard before mass production.

For programs with multiple shipments, carton and lot labeling helps trace defects. You need to know whether the issue came from one coating batch, one assembly shift, one packing method, or the full order.

Buyer rule: if mirror lens color is part of your brand identity, treat it as a controlled material, not a decoration detail.

Inspect before balance payment and shipment

Final inspection for mirrored sunglasses should cover more than carton counts. Use consistent light. Handle the product by the frame, not the coated lens. Pull samples from different cartons and different parts of the packed order.

If buying for retail, define inspection level and defect limits before production. Visible mirror scratches in the central viewing area should usually be treated as serious cosmetic defects. They affect appearance and user acceptance. Low-cost promotional sunglasses may allow wider tolerance, but the rule still needs to be written. Clear standards reduce disputes after cartons are packed.

Which mirror colors are hardest to keep consistent in bulk? Red, orange, rose, and some gold mirrors often show shade differences clearly because small coating or base-tint changes are easy to see. Blue can shift toward purple or cyan if the base tint changes. Silver is more neutral in color, but it reveals scratches, pinholes, fingerprints, and cleaning marks. For these colors, approve a physical master sample and check first bulk lenses before full assembly.

What should a mirror lens specification include? Include lens material, thickness and tolerance, base tint, mirror color, VLT or lens category, UV requirement, applicable compliance standard, polarization requirement if any, surface defect tolerance, handling method, packing method, and signed physical master sample reference. Also state whether the order may be coated in multiple lots and how those lots should be labeled.

Is a small MOQ enough for a custom mirror sunglasses order? It can be enough for a test order, sample sale, influencer drop, or retailer presentation. The risk is that buyers sometimes treat small orders casually and skip documentation. Even for a small run, approve a physical master sample, record the lens material and base tint, and keep the reorder file. If the test succeeds, those records make the larger order easier to reproduce.

How do we prevent reorder mismatch on mirrored lenses? Keep a signed master sample and a detailed reorder file with lens material, thickness, base tint, mirror color, frame color, logo method, packaging, compliance notes, and previous inspection results. Before the reorder is fully assembled, ask the factory to compare first coated lenses against the retained master. If the master is damaged or aged, approve a fresh standard before mass production.

Do mirrored lenses need special packing? Often, yes. High-reflection coatings such as silver and gold show rubbing marks quickly. Use tray separation, individual lens or frame bags, clean gloves, non-abrasive cloths, or protective film when needed. Define these requirements before quotation because added protection can affect packing cost, labor, and lead time.
